WebSep 22, 2024 · Buy why volume is so crucial for selecting stocks for swing trading. Well, let us discuss this: 2. Volume. Volume is an essential tool for swing traders as it helps them analyze the strength of a new trend. The main reason behind this is that a trend with high volume will be stronger than one with weak volume.
